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os litigation, which includes lawsuits and trust fund claims. To be able to successfully handle these claims, they must be knowledgeable of state laws as well as the national legal requirements.

They should also have access to asbestos databases of workplaces and be able to identify asbestos manufacturers who may be responsible for the exposure. The right asbestos lawyer will make the process easier, so that victims can focus on their treatment and be with their families.

Meeting with a mesothelioma lawyer for a free evaluation of your case is the first step to file an asbestos lawsuit. Your lawyer will assist you to decide on the best claim for your case and which corporations should be held accountable. Exposure to asbestos can occur in a variety of forms, and it may be difficult for people to recall precisely the time they were exposed, or at what locations. However, mesothelioma lawyers have access to databases that provide a list of thousands of companies as well as products and job sites where asbestos exposure occurred.

Asbestos lawyers are also able to investigate the details of a case and locate evidence to support your assertions. For instance, you may have medical records to prove the diagnosis of mesothelioma or an official death certificate that lists "mesothelioma" as the reason for your loved one's death. Asbestos attorneys are familiar with the process of ordering these documents and are aware of the you should ask for in order to get the most info from them.

A mesothelioma attorney who is skilled will also be aware of how state laws affect the method you make your claim. For instance the law in New York requires that you bring your case in the state of the company responsible for your asbestos exposure is located in that state. Attorneys from nationwide firms have experience in filing claims across multiple states and understand the law in each jurisdiction.

Mesothelioma is a life-threatening and painful condition, affects the lung linings. It is caused by exposure to asbestos which was used in a range of residential and commercial construction materials for more than 30 years. The exposure can have occurred in a number of different ways, including at work or in schools, as well as in the military and at home.

If someone is diagnosed with mesothelioma, they may bring a personal injury lawsuit against the company that is responsible for their asbestos exposure. They can also file for the compensation of loved ones who have passed away from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ses.

Asbestos sufferers can receive financial reimbursement for expenses such as lost wages, medical costs and costs for treatment. Asbestos lawyers can help clients get these damages back by filing a mesothelioma lawsuit or a trust fund claim against the companies that are responsible for asbestos exposure. They can also assist clients in filing a w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f a loved one that has died from mesothelioma.

An attorney for mesothelioma can determine if the patient has an appropriate claim and assist them in filing a lawsuit, VA claim or trust fund. The value of each mesothelioma claim is unique and is determined by several factors, including the victim's asbestos exposure, their age at diagnosis, and the amount they've suffered as a result of the disease. Compensation may cover future and past medical expenses and lost wages, as well as the loss of a loved one and legal costs, punitive damages and pain and suffering.
